No Water Flowing Out From The Faucet:
Sometimes, when you turn on the faucet, you see no water coming out. This happens because there is some blockage in your faucet. Deposit of minerals is the most common reason for faucet blockage. Therefore, you have to focus on removing the buildups from the chambers. You can use a toothbrush and some vinegar to remove the sediments. You can contact a professional plumber if this method doesn’t work.

Noise From The Faucet:
Many times, faucets make noise when they are turned on. This happens generally because the washer gets loose. You can fix this issue just by tightening the loose washer. However, if tightening the washer doesn’t solve your problem, you can even consider replacing the washer. Sometimes, these excessive noises can be due to some issues in the pipe. Calling a plumber to deal with whistling or screaming from the pipe is suggested.
Dripping Faucet:
A leaking or dripping faucet is one of the biggest problems that almost every household experiences. It not only wastes water but also increases your water bills. Dripping faucets can also damage your furniture. Therefore, you must pay attention to this issue before it worsens. The faucet generally starts dripping because of the worn-out washer or O-ring inside the valve. Check them properly and replace them.
Loose Fitting Or Installation:
Loose fitting or installation of the faucet can lead to the destruction of your sink and faucet. It can even damage your cabinets and counters. You must tighten the nuts responsible for the faucet’s loose fitting to avoid this situation. Remove all the important stuff below the sink before tightening your faucet installation.
